White wood stain

This substance is recommended for gentle lightening of floors. Unfortunately, it does not create a protective layer on the surface and requires additional application of varnish on top. This stain is applied with a brush or cotton cloth. After about 4 hours, the floor should be lightly sanded with sandpaper, then cleaned of dust and applied varnish. After the first layer of varnish has dried, you can apply a second one.

Preparatory stage

At the preparatory stage, it is necessary to carefully check the floor surface on which the parquet board is laid. Check its condition, make sure that there are no nail heads sticking out of the parquet. If there are any, then you should drive them deeper or remove them using pliers or wire cutters. All this must be done so as not to subsequently damage the grinding and scraping machines.

Make sure that the parquet does not creak, has no cracks, and does not move away from the floor. Otherwise, you will need to re-glue the parquet board. After this, you should wash the parquet surface using special detergents. Next, wait until it dries completely. The next stage of work requires removing the top layers of wax and varnish. So, before scraping you need to use solvents (regular White Spirit will do). After you have cleared the floor as much as possible of the top layer of wax, proceed to sanding.

Parquet scraping

This will require a special scraping machine, as well as skills to work with it. However, if you have such a car, then you probably have an idea of ​​how to operate it. Otherwise, use the services of a professional.

Before applying varnish, make sure that the parquet does not move away from the floor and does not creak.

Using a scraping machine, the top layers of parquet that contain old varnish are removed. If you do not first clean the parquet with solvents, then the knives of the scraping machine will quickly become dull. Dull knives can cause chips and cracks on the parquet board. Approximately 8–10 mm needs to be removed.

Sanding parquet

After finishing the sanding process, you need to remove excess debris from the surface and proceed to grinding. For this you will need a special grinding machine. The device of such a machine is a round axis with a plane on which sandpaper circles are attached. The first step is high-grit sandpaper (30 to 40), the second step is medium-grit (60-80), and the final step is low-grit (100 and above). No, we were not mistaken: the lower the number, the grier the sandpaper. Ideally, a smoother transition between grain sizes ensures the highest quality of work performed.

By the way, in hard-to-reach places (corners, under the battery) you will need a “boot”. It is a smaller version of a grinding machine. In extreme cases, you will have to do a little manual work.

Perfectly clean surface

After sanding parquet, never use a household vacuum cleaner.

Finally, you will need to remove all debris from the surface. Use a construction vacuum cleaner for this. Don’t even think about using a regular home vacuum cleaner for these purposes if you don’t want to run to the store after finishing the work for a new filter and dust collector.

After this, re-check the floor surface for chips and cracks. If there is a crack, it should be sealed with putty. Immediately before applying the primer and varnish, it is necessary to seal the seams between the parquet boards with a special solution for seams. After this, wait for this solution to dry and go through the sander again (but only with fine-grained sandpaper), remove debris from the surface, and wipe it.

Quick-drying varnish for wood

If you want to get a durable and impenetrable coating in the shortest possible time, you can use a quick-drying varnish. It can be applied with a flat or oval brush, or with a roller. It is recommended to apply 2 layers with an interval of 6 hours. To get the best effect, sand the first coat with sandpaper, then remove the dust, wipe with a damp cloth and, after drying, paint again.

Alkali for wood

This substance is used for light wood species such as pine, spruce, birch, ash or maple. Work with it should be carried out exclusively with the use of protective equipment, since it is quite aggressive. For application, it is best to use a soft cotton cloth or brush, and after the layer of solution has dried, you need to sand the surface, remove dust and saturate the parquet with oil. A whitewashed floor protected in this way can be put into operation in about a day.

Before you begin the main work, you need to understand the types of dyes that can be used to finish the surface of the floor covering. The floor can be treated with the following compounds:

  • Special paint for wood products.
  • Stain. This composition compares favorably with the others; it allows you to highlight the natural texture of the wood.
  • Tinting varnish allows you to obtain painted parquet of a certain color depending on the composition. This solution protects wood from the harmful effects of moisture.
  • Special mastics are able to restore the original texture of parquet and have protective properties. Such compositions protect the material from moisture and mechanical damage.

Applying a paint layer

Tools are of great importance for the correct application of the coating, so painting parquet should begin with the selection of suitable rollers and brushes. Most often, paint rollers (made of wool or mohair) with a long handle are used for this. Foam rollers are not suitable for painting parquet, as they can slip and leave marks that are noticeable after drying. The compositions can also be applied with a brush, and if they are liquid enough, with special sprayers.


Applying varnish

Let's look at how to paint parquet with your own hands step by step:

  1. It is necessary to make sure that the floor is even and clean.
  2. Make sure that the room is well ventilated, as fumes from some varnishes and paints can be harmful to health.
  3. Use a protective suit to avoid damaging your clothes and wear a respirator.
  4. The paint and varnish composition is applied starting from the far corner of the room, in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ions.
  5. When you start applying the coating, you need to make sure that no drops of paint remain on the still unpainted surface. In case they do appear, you should keep a dry cloth nearby to remove them. It is better to remove traces of paint immediately.
  6. If varnishing is carried out, the parquet is usually coated with several layers of varnish. In this case, each new one is applied across the previous one. The intervals between applying a new layer should be at least two days.
  7. After finishing painting or varnishing, the parquet should be allowed to dry, then you can apply the next layer if you need to achieve a more saturated shade.

Note! Drying of paint and varnish mixtures, as a rule, occurs in 8-12 hours (unless otherwise indicated on the packaging of the product). After this time, you can walk on the floor, but placing furniture or laying carpets is not recommended. It is permissible to fully use the coating after no less than 14 days.


Caring for parquet
In order for your parquet to serve for a long time, you need to pay attention not only to proper processing and painting, but also to its further care. For optimal operation in the room, you need to maintain a temperature of 15⁰C-25⁰C and air humidity of about 50%.

If the parquet has been varnished, then cleaning must be done without using water using special cleaning agents. It is also not recommended to walk on varnished surfaces in shoes, and to reduce the load from furniture legs, felt heels should be placed under them. Take care of your parquet properly!
